Leonard James Mourning Waller 1751–1826 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1751
Birth Location: Spotsylvania County, Virginia, United States of America
Death Date: 1826
Death Location: Ninety Six, Greenwood County, South Carolina, United States of America
Father: Capt. Weller\WALLER
Mother: Mary Waller
Spouse(s):
Children(s):
The story of Leonard James Mourning Waller began in 1751 in Spotsylvania County, Virginia, United States of America. Leonard James Mourning Waller passed away in 1826 in Ninety Six, Greenwood County, South Carolina, United States of America.
